Description Tomás Cohen Arazi 2023-07-25 17:50:59 UTC
It is easy to spot the issue by entering [here](https://api.koha-community.org/Development.html).

On the left column, some tags are nicely translated into descriptions (e.g. 'SMTP servers') and some others are not (e.g. 'search_filters').

We need to solve it, and enforce it at QA.

Bug 34387: Improve API docs naming consistency

This patch aims to make our API docs be more consistent.
It addresses two particular things:

* There's no consistency on the `tags` used across the spec, and not all
  of them are correctly described and have an `x-displayName` entry.
  More on this later.
* This are not sorted either by some for of grouping, or at least
  alphabetically.

For the former, I did my best trying to harmonize (specially on the ERM
front) with what we do in the rest of the use cases.

For the latter, I opted for sorting everything alphabetically, as a
first step. Hoping someone else could work on grouping things.

To test (ON YOUR HOST MACHINE):
1. On current master run:
   $ cd api/v1/swagger
   $ docker run --rm -v $(pwd):/api --workdir /api redocly/cli \
           build-docs swagger.yaml --output index.html
=> SUCCESS: It doesn't break or anything
2. Open your browser, open the generated api/v1/swagger/index.html file
=> FAIL: The left column has
         * several lower case entries
         * not everything is correctly grouped (ERM? packages?)
         * Things are not sorted. There's an attempt but looks messy
3. Apply this patch
4. Repeat 1 and 2
=> SUCCESS: Things look much better!
5. Sign off :-D

CAVEAT1: I'm not sure why, but import_batches doesn't work. Ideas are
welcome, I'll keep looking for fixes.
CAVEAT2: I don't have enough eHoldings background to weight in, but I
feel like 'ERM eHoldings packages' could just be 'ERM packages'.
Follw-up patches with better ideas are welcome.
CAVEAT3: Patron credits, debits, balance... They could all go in to
'Patrons accounts' or similar. Open to ideas.
CAVEAT4: Old redocly didn't support mapping an endpoint to more than one
target section. Something to explore if we want (for example) to reach
'credits' through the 'Patrons' section but also from 'Accounting'.

This is a great improvement..

* I couldn't work out why import_batches isn't working either.. very strange.
* I'll ask Matt/Jonathan to comment on the ERM stuff
* I'd love to see us use grouping later, but I don't think our redocly versions support it yet (and likely it'll all work better with the next swagger too)
* The patron accounting endpoints feel like they need some cleaning up.. they're not all that consistent right now.

All in all, I think this is a great starting point.. we should probably add some qa rules and accompanying tools around ensuring tagging takes place going forward.

I think we should probably go with what's here for now and keep refining in other bugs.
